Geometrically Optimized Phase Configurations and Sub-conductors in the Bundle for Power Transmission Efficiency
This paper develops a revolutionary design for transmission lines by shifting phase configurations and sub-conductors into unconventional arrangements that are geometrically optimized, leading to very high surge impedance loading (HSIL) and very low corridor width (CW) (ultra SIL/CW).
